I agree to an extent. The OL we have on the team right now are suited more for a zone block scheme. They need wide splits, because they are, as a whole, undersized. We don't have the OL to do a power block scheme, but that is what Pittman and Chaney are accustomed to. They typically get the biggest OL they can get, then say "We are running the ball, try to stop us." Right now our OL can't do that. Call it size, strength, whatever. (I think it is a combination)
Our OL is built for a zone blocking scheme and we are trying to run a power block scheme.
Pittman/Chaney are not comfortable with a smaller OL. We don't have the big Olinemen it takes to do a power blocking scheme, but that is what they know and teach best.
